Conditions

Chlamydia trachomatis std venereal disease

Interventions

Implementation (regional) of selective systematic home-based screening for chlamydia trachomatis. In Amsterdam and Rotterdam (high population density) all members of the target population will be in

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 16-29 age bracket sexual active registred in standard municipal registers of Amsterdam/Rotterdam/South Limburg

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Younger than 16 years Older than 29 years not sexual active

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
· Response rate of 30% (individuals who actually send in their samples to the laboratory) · Ct-positivity rate between 3-5%

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Impact of Chlamydia screening on ct-prevalence (which can be achieved by chlamydia trend analysis) and the impact on PID-rates. The results of this implementation will be leading for the decision about the national roll-out of screening in the Netherlands.
